using System;
using System.Threading;
using AlgorithmsAndDataStructures.DataStructures.Concurrency;
using Xunit;
namespace AlgorithmsAndDataStructures.Tests.DataStructures.Concurrency;
public class SimpleTokenBucketTests
{
[Fact]
public void CanSendCorrectPacket()
{
using var sut = new SimpleTokenBucket(101, 100, 2000);
var producer = new Thread(Send);
var result = false;
producer.Start();
producer.Join();
void Send()
{
result = sut.TrySend(100);
}
Assert.True(result);
}
[Fact]
public void PacketBiggerThenBucketIsDropped()
{
using var sut = new SimpleTokenBucket(101, 100, 2000);
var producer = new Thread(Send);
var result = true;
producer.Start();
producer.Join();
void Send()
{
result = sut.TrySend(102);
}
Assert.False(result);
}
[Fact]
public void DropPacketsWhenThereAreNotEnoughTokens()
{
using var sut = new SimpleTokenBucket(100, 100, 20000);
var producer = new Thread(Send);
var result1 = false;
var result2 = true;
producer.Start();
producer.Join();
void Send()
{
result1 = sut.TrySend(100);
result2 = sut.TrySend(100);
}
Assert.True(result1);
Assert.False(result2);
}
[Fact]
public void DropPacketsWhenQueueIsFull()
{
using var sut = new SimpleTokenBucket(200, 100, 20000);
var producer = new Thread(Send);
var result1 = false;
var result2 = false;
var result3 = true;
producer.Start();
producer.Join();
void Send()
{
result1 = sut.TrySend(100);
result2 = sut.TrySend(100);
result3 = sut.TrySend(100);
}
Assert.True(result1);
Assert.True(result2);
Assert.False(result3);
}
[Fact]
public void LeaksWithConstantRate()
{
using var sut = new SimpleTokenBucket(200, 100, 20000);
var producer = new Thread(Send);
var result1 = false;
var result2 = false;
var result3 = true;
var result4 = false;
producer.Start();
producer.Join();
void Send()
{
result1 = sut.TrySend(100);
result2 = sut.TrySend(100);
result3 = sut.TrySend(100);
Thread.Sleep(TimeSpan.FromMilliseconds(30000));
result4 = sut.TrySend(100);
}
Assert.True(result1);
Assert.True(result2);
Assert.False(result3);
Assert.True(result4);
}
}
